Limit users to a single RDS session across all servers in collection (Server 2016)

$
0
0

Hello everyone,

I have a Remote Desktop Services deployment consisting of:

  • RD Connection Broker + RD Licensing (one server)
  • RD Web Access + RD Gateway (one server)
  • RD Session Hosts (Variable number of servers, usually more than one, autoscaled)

Everything works great except for the fact that sometimes users are able to open sessions on more than one server; please see the (edited) screenshot here: imgur.com/a/In4qk

I have set the Group Policy rule called "Restrict Remote Desktop Services users to a single Remote Desktop Services session" (under Computer Configuration/Policies/Administrative Templates/Windows Components/Remote Desktop Services/Remote Desktop Session Host/Connections) to Enabled, however the description for that policy states (emphasis mine):

If you enable this policy setting, users who log on remotely by using Remote Desktop Services will be restricted to a single session (either active or disconnected)on that server.

What I want to achieve is basically the same as what the GPO rule states but across all servers in the collection, ie., in the screenshot above, the user would be reconnected to the disconnected session on IP-AC1F42FF instead of getting a new one on the other server.

What compounds to the problem is the fact we're using User Profile Disks which cannot be mounted multiple times. This means that any additional sessions will have a temporary profile loaded with default settings. That leads to problems with, for example, users' regional and other profile settings which are critical for our application.

Any help appreciated.

OpenGL and Remote Desktop

$
0
0

We have OpenGL application working on a server computer.  If later we connect via RDP to this server, OpenGL application continues to function without any problems. Obviously RDP just transfers image from server to remote computer.

If we start the same OpenGL application on the same server from RDP session, it runs OpenGL not on server but on the remote computer. Application crashes on operations that require OpenGL 2.0 or higher.

Is there any way to force RDP to run OpenGL code always on server no matter how it was started, directly on server or from remote computer?
